What to Eat

Livigno is known for its traditional Italian cuisine.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Pizzoccheri: A type of buckwheat pasta served with melted cheese, cabbage, and potatoes.
  • Sciatt: A type of fried cheese ball.
  • Bresaola: A type of cured beef.
